Puerto Rico: Caribbean Thunder 2024 Medical Evacuation
Puerto Rico - August 07, 2024
The U.S. Army Reserve 407th Medical Company Ground Ambulance, under the 1st Mission Support Command, conducted comprehensive Medical Evacuation Training using both ground and aerial methods, facilitated by a rotorcraft from the Puerto Rico National Guard. This crucial training, part of the Mission Essential Task (MET), reinforces the collaborative relationship between U.S. Army soldiers as they prepare for future disaster response operations in Puerto Rico. The exercise took place at Camp Santiago in Salinas, P.R., on August 7, 2024.
